  • Physical Optics Corporation
    Group Leader/Research Scientist
    Physical Optics Corporation Jun 2006 - Jun 2008
    Researched and developed novel products by identifying emerging technologies, utilizing them to fulfill immediate government needs, and then leveraging these developed technologies into marketable products.• Originated and developed custom automated UV curable mask applied via high deposition rate inkjet system for applying coatings to aircraft. Partnered with Northrop for masking of Joint Strike Fighter components.• Managed and designed a membrane-based CO2 sensor project for detecting humans in cargo containers that leveraged the sensitivity of self-mixing laser interferometry and custom gas separation membranes.• Developed novel biological filtration system in which atmospheric glow plasma and photocatalytic reactions isolate and neutralize airborne biohazardous agents for high efficiency biological filtration with personal, vehicle, or building application.• Provided project support for multiple projects in the form of optomechanical design, custom test apparatus, data acquisition system, experiment design, and rapid prototype development.• Prepared SBIR funding proposals for original research with 20% win rate (SBIR average is 10%) resulting in $930,000 in funding.• As group leader, supervised three engineers and one research scientist including delegation of work assignments, proposal review, and project oversight.
  • Uc Irvine
    Teaching And Research Assistant
    Uc Irvine Sep 2000 - Dec 2005
    Developed prototype additive manufacturing PDM system to build arbitrary metallic (aluminum and solder) 3D objects one drop at a time from computer files without a tool. • Studied multi-droplet splat solidification with a numerical simulation of 200 μm molten metal drops that allows for re-melting. • Simulated, designed, implemented, and tested a high frequency vibrational structure to improve aluminum droplet generation. • Developed and tested an in-flight convective droplet heating apparatus capable of heating droplet streams at a rate of 11,000 deg C per second.• Improved PDM system integration, calibration, and build path planning.
